- Haven’t heard any rumors. The “everything sucks at AA” crowd will tell you that AA has farmed out all flying to JetBlue and the base is going to go away any day now. Others will claim that a 320 category will open there at some point. I’d imagine the truth is somewhere in between.

- More or less the same type of flying any 737 domicile does. It’s a “D” category but all that really means is no extended overwater flights, so don’t expect to see BDA, etc. Could still see MEX. A mix of 1-5 day trips with 1-3 legs per day.

- Junior CA appears to be a May 2008 hire. BOS isn’t too senior on the FO side, but, like the other smallish bases, those that want to be BOS based tend to post up there until they retire/die. Youngest CA is 52 years old.

I imagine many end up commuting to LGA 777/737/320 for better movement.
